Buds on a Budget: Bahama Bussdown

Posted on December 22, 2024 by James Bridges

Bahama Bussdown: A Strain That Lifts You Up

There’s nothing like walking into Rob & Sons Canna Co and catching up with Brandy, my go-to budtender who always knows how to spot the best “bud on a budget” finds. On my most recent visit, she had four different strains ready for me to explore, including one that piqued my interest—Bahama Bussdown, grown by Danky McNuggy. Without the chance to smell the buds in-store, I had to wait until I got home to truly discover what this strain had to offer.

About Bahama Bussdown: Strain Profile
Bahama Bussdown is an indica-dominant hybrid, perfect for those who want to relax without losing that spark of creativity and energy. Its genetics often trace back to strains known for their pungent, earthy aromas, balanced with piney and spicy notes that make it truly stand out. This combination of genetics gives Bahama Bussdown its unique effects—an uplifting experience that melts away anxiety while stimulating focus and creativity.

First Impressions: Smell & Appearance
The moment I got home, I opened the bag to check out Bahama Bussdown. Pouring out the small buds, I was greeted with a stunning display of colors—shades of olive green and pine green glistening under a blanket of amber trichomes. These smalls weren’t just visually appealing; they had a chunky, dense structure that signaled a solid, well-cured flower.

The aroma was a revelation. Piney, earthy, gassy, and spicy—all the classic notes of a dank and heavy strain. The scent immediately filled the room, wrapping around my senses like a familiar, comforting embrace. If you’re a fan of pungent strains that come with a powerful nose, Bahama Bussdown will hit all the right notes.

Breaking It Down & Smoking Experience
Breaking apart the buds was a breeze—they broke up chunky without turning into powder, perfectly balanced between sticky and dry. It made prepping for a smoke easy, whether you’re rolling a joint or packing a bowl.

When it came time to light up, Bahama Bussdown did not disappoint. The first inhale was thick and full, carrying the earthy, piney, and spicy flavors I had detected earlier. It’s a heavy smoke, with each puff providing a rich, deep taste that’s both complex and satisfying.

Effects & Overall Experience
It didn’t take long for the effects to kick in. Almost immediately, I felt a relaxing wave wash over me, melting away any stress or anxiety. But this isn’t the kind of strain that makes you want to doze off—it has an uplifting edge, sparking creativity and bringing a gentle boost of energy. Bahama Bussdown keeps you alert and motivated, making it a great choice whether you’re looking to dive into a creative project, chill with friends, or simply take the edge off after a long day.

The versatility of this strain stands out; it strikes that perfect balance between unwinding and staying engaged. Whether you’re seeking to relax without feeling couch-locked or needing a little extra inspiration for the day, Bahama Bussdown’s mix of mellow and stimulating effects will carry you through.

Final Thoughts
Danky McNuggy’s Bahama Bussdown, recommended by Rob & Sons Canna Co, is an all-around winner for those seeking a budget-friendly option without sacrificing quality. Its gorgeous appearance, strong aroma, and balanced effects make it a must-try for any enthusiast.

If you find yourself near Shawnee and want to pick up something that both relaxes and invigorates, Bahama Bussdown might just be your new go-to. A strain that effortlessly blends relaxation, creativity, and energy is rare to find—so when you come across it, you know it’s a keeper.
